人体对电流的反应

随着科技的飞速发展,各种电器设备的数量急剧增加,但同时也带来了更多的触电事故,因此,安全用电被人们所重视.人们往往认为:触电危害的原因是接触了高压,而触电危害的真正原因是有较大的电流通过人体.人体受到电击时,电流对人体的伤害程度主要与流过人体电流的大小有关,当手触及50Hz交变电流时,人体的反应如下表所示:

电流(mA)人体反应
0.6-1.5手轻微颤抖
2-3手指强烈颤抖
5-7手部肌肉痉挛
8-10手难摆脱带电体,但还能摆脱,手指尖到手腕剧痛
20-25手迅速麻痹,不能自动摆脱电源,手剧痛,呼吸困难
50-80呼吸麻痹,心房开始震颤
90-100呼吸麻痹,延续3s就会造成心脏麻痹
除电流大小的原因外,触电的部位、电流经过人体的时间也会影响触电的伤害程度.如果电流长时间通过人体,人体电阻会下降,即使电流很小,也是比较危险的.
